We show that every sufficiently large-regular digraphwhich has linear degree and is a robust outexpander has an approximate decomposition into edge-disjoint Hamilton cycles, i.e.,contains a set ofedge-disjoint Hamilton cycles. Hereis a robust outexpander if for every setwhich is not too small and not too large, the “robust” outneighborhood ofis a little larger than. This generalizes a result of Kühn, Osthus, and Treglown on approximate Hamilton decompositions of dense regular oriented graphs. It also generalizes a result of Frieze and Krivelevich on approximate Hamilton decompositions of quasirandom (di)graphs. In turn, our result is used as a tool by Kühn and Osthus to prove that any sufficiently large-regular digraphwhich has linear degree and is a robust outexpander even has a Hamilton decomposition.
